                  xxxxI N T R O D U C T I O N

                          A new viral disease is discovered in 2017 by medical staff in Mexico. Shorly after it is reported that the same disease has known cases in Argentina, Austria, China, England, Jordan, New Zealand, and South Africa. Symptoms are reported to be flu like but are different and varying in severity depending on the patient, there is no consistancy between age groups or gender and appears to have no pattern. Interesting but certainly no more than a few medical scientists become interested at this point. In 2019 global news stations reported that a man in China, who was suffering from dementia, suddenly turned violent and killed five innocent people during a senseless rampage. He was shot once in the head. A few weeks later a similar incident occured in Mexico and rabies was labelled as the possible cause. Within a month more cases of unprovoked mass murders were being reported, and each time the murderer was found to be senseless and derranged during the attack. Within a few months the World Health Organization (WHO) had ruled out many possible causes and encouraged global leaders to fund more research for this disturbing health problem. By 2020 the first link between the virus discovered in 2017 and the attacks that started in 2019 is made, and before the end of the year the link has been proven, anyone who has suffered from the virus has slowly been suffering from mental deteriation, increased aggression, rabid/unprovoked hostility and eventually death. Following this disturbing discovery focus shifts to finding a cure for the newly dubbed CD-892 virus.

                          Leading into 2028 over half the global population has been infected with CD-892, and the infected are at varying stages of mental deterrioation. Some countries, particularily ones with low GDP, have already crumbled under the effects of the virus, no longer able to afford the care their people need and so their economies have completely collapsed. North America, now working closesly with Canada, remains the most active economically and working towards a cure. Joint military efforts keep people quarrentied, under control and deal with those that are too far gone. In the same year it comes to public attention that the National Insitute of Mental Health (NIMH) has been conducting experiments on animals to find a way to increase mental function and accuity in humans. Not a cure for the virus but a possible means of delaying the mental degredation.

                          By 2031 most of the global population is dead, dying or being violently slaughtered by deranged humans. America and Canda still remain the global leaders in the race to find a cure for CD-892, but things are beginning to show signs of breaking down. Following the discovery that NIMH is using animal experimentation it came to light that they are primarily using canines for their research, because the number of unwanted dogs in the world vastly increased over the last decade. This year animal rights activists launched an assault on 8 NIMH research facilities spread across Canada and North America in states close to the Canadian boarder. Their actions released nearly 2000 experimental dogs into the wilds, and close to half that number were treated with an experimental drug. That experimental drug known as Anatlen has increased the natural abilities of the NIMH dogs, most notably giving them increased intelligence, improved senses and better reflexes. Also these dogs have slightly longer lifespans, including marginally better immune systems and cell regeneration. Despite the best efforts of the NIMH employees and the government, only 10 experimental dogs were recovered. By 2035 the American and Canadian governments finally collapsed and any hope of curing CD-892 crumbled along with them.

                  xxxxB E H A V I O R

                          Dog pack behaviour is similar to that of a wolf pack in the sense that they work together as a team, while having a set heirarchy with the Alpha pair being highest and most respected in the pack. Alphas are the leaders of the pack and together they make the important decisions regarding their pack, but that being said the Alpha Male is typically more dominant than the Alpha Female when it comes to decision making, but this is not always the case. Dogs are broken down into ranks which hold a important role to the pack, but also determine their place in the heirarchy. Higher ranking dogs will normally display more dominance, where as lower ranking dogs will be more submissive. Submission is shown to those that hold high ranks as a form of respect, a simple tucked tail, averting eyes, pinned back ears, and/or lowering their stature (belly close to the ground) are all signs of submission. These signals can also be used to show when a dog is frightened, unsure or just not very confident about something. Dogs which are more dominant will often show it by holding their head high and proud, their tail will occasionally be seen flipped high, and their ears fully erect but this may be difficult to see in some breeds. When trying to prove their dominance the dog will likely perform all these motions while also maintaining eye contact, snarling and invading personal space. Dogs which do not submit to these signals may begin a fight between the two dominant dogs. However if a high ranking dog displays dominance to a lower ranking dog and the low ranking dog does not submit this is disrespectful. High ranking dogs may force lower ranked dogs into submission by being forced to the ground and pinned there. In extreme situations the higher ranking dog may, if possible, bite or clamp their jaw over the muzzle of the lower ranked dog while it is pinned on the ground. Remember that if you are a playing a lower ranked dog and chose to disrespect a higher ranked dog you are asking for trouble - and the Alpha or Beta may even become involved and issue additional punishments. During friendly encounters dogs like to be physical when greeting one another. They will likely sniff over the other dog, usually to check where they have been and/or their health and condition - dogs can learn a lot from their sense of smell. They may also provide licks to the muzzle or simply bump their nose and/or bodies together and/or wag their tails if they are familiar with the dog they are greeting. The level of affection displayed depends on how well the dogs know each other and also their ranks. When greeting strangers, and choosing not to react with hostility, a dogs tail will frozen in posistion which can be down or erect depending on how the dog 'feels' about the stranger (refer to submission and dominance). They may also avoid physical contact, unless its aggressive contact, and thus remain visibly neutral towards the stranger. Besides all these physical indicators dogs can also express their feelings verbally (eg barks, snarls, whines etc). xx

                  xxxxH E A L I N G xI N F O

                          Healing list should be used by Menders in their posts when they are healing sickness and injury, to ensure we are all consistent.
                          All the information for this list was provided with permission by the lovely SniKenna.


                                xAlder Bark (Tree)

                                    Flowers and leaves can reduce swelling and prevent infection when chewed and applied to a wound.
                                    Bark may be chewed by a dog with toothache to reduce pain, swelling and treat gum disease.


                                xAloe Vera

                                    Gel inside of its leaves can be used to treat skin problems or burns.


                                xBindweed

                                    Stems leak a sticky sap when broken that can be used to secure sticks onto limbs to help heal broken bones.


                                xBorage Leaves

                                    Leaves can be chewed and eaten by nursing dogs to promote milk production.
                                    They can also be used to reduce fevers.


                                xBurdock

                                    Leaves may be chewed and applied to wounds that are clear of infection to speed healing.
                                    Roots may be chewed and applied to a wound to draw infection from it.


                                xCatchweed

                                    Burrs from this plant can be placed painlessly over treated wounds to prevent poultices from being rubbed off.


                                xCobwebs

                                    These can be gathered and pressed into wounds to stop bleeding.
                                    Only use for wounds that are bleeding heavily, as they have the potential to increase the likelihood of infection.


                                xColtsfoot

                                    Leaves are chewed into a pulp that can ease breathing, or be applied to soothe cracked or sore paw pads.


                                xComfrey Root

                                    Roots are chewed into a poultice to help repair broken bones or soothe wounds.
                                    They can also be used to relieve itching or soothe stiff joints.


                                xDandelion

                                    Leaves can be chewed to act as painkillers.
                                    The stems excrete a white liquid that can be applied to soothe and help heal bee stings.


                                xDock

                                    Leaves can be chewed up and applied to scratches.
                                    The application process on scratches may sting patient slightly.


                                xEchinacea

                                    Flowers and leaves can chewed and applied to a wound to ease infection.


                                xFennel

                                    Stalks of this plant can be broken and the juice squeezed into a dog's mouth to relieve hip pain.


                                xFeverfew

                                    Eating the whole plant can reduce the body temperature of dogs with fever or chills.
                                    It can also relieve aches, pains and especially headaches.


                                xGoldenrod

                                    Plant is chewed into a poultice and promotes healing when applied to wounds.


                                xHorsetail

                                    Plant can be chewed into a poultice and applied to wounds to treat infections and stop bleeding.


                                xJuniper

                                    Berries ease the stomach and can serve as a counter-poison.
                                    Leaves are used to ease coughs and other respiratory problems.


                                xLavender

                                    Eating leaves and flowers are particularly good at easing pain in a dog's head and throat.
                                    Inhaling the scent of these fresh flowers can also calm the nerves and promote sleep.
                                    This herb is used to cover the scent of death when a dog has passed on.


                                xMallow Leaves

                                    Leaves are eaten to soothe bellyaches.


                                xMarigold

                                    Leaves and flowers can be consumed to relieve chills.
                                    Leaves and petals can be chewed and placed on wounds to prevent infection.


                                xNightshade

                                    Consumed berries will kill the dog who swallows them if he or she is not given immediate help, and even then they may still die.
                                    Roots and leaves may be chewed together and applied to sore places, but must never be applied to open wounds.
                                    This is a poison in addition to a healing plant.


                                xParsley

                                    Entire plant is eaten by a nursing dog to prevent milk production should her pups die, be too old for milk or should she be producing too much.


                                xPoppy Seeds

                                    Seeds can be chewed on to help a dog sleep, soothe shock or distress, or ease pain.
                                    Large amounts can lead to death. Not recommended for nursing dogs.


                                xRagweed

                                    Chewing on the leaves of this plant can give a dog extra strength and energy.


                                xRush

                                    Plant is bound around broken limbs to set them in place.


                                xSnakeroot

                                    Plant is chewed and applied to snake bites to alleviate the affects of poison.


                                xSticks

                                    Large sticks are placed inside the mouths of patients in pain to bite when painkillers are not enough.
                                    Sticks are also used as part of casts to help set and heal broken bones.


                                xStinging Nettle

                                    Seeds can be eaten by a dog who has been poisoned to induced vomiting.
                                    Leaves can be chewed into a poultice and applied to wounds to reduce swelling.
                                    When combined with Comfrey, this herb can help heal broken bones.


                                xTansy

                                    Leaves, flowers, and stems should be eaten together to rid a dog of worms or poisons.
                                    Leaves may be chewed to relieve joint aches.
                                    Flowers should be consumed to alleviate coughs.
                                    Pregnant dogs should never be given Tansy, for it has the potential to cause a miscarriage.


                                xThyme

                                    Can be consumed to calm an anxious dog, or to aid in bringing on a restful sleep.


                                xWillow (Tree)

                                    Water from beneath the bark of a flowering willow tree may be dripped into a dog's eyes to help clear blurriness of vision. It can be applied to skin to soothe itchiness.
                                    Willow bark may be consumed to ease pain, act against inflammation, and ease diarrhea or fevers.
                                    Willow leaves, when eaten, can stop a dog from vomiting.


                                xYarrow

                                    Leaves can be consumed to induce vomiting, or chewed and applied to wounds to relieve pain and prevent infection.


                                xYew

                                    Consuming parts of this plant can force a dog to vomit up poisons.
